WebAn individual dog licence, which costs €20 and is valid for 1 year. A 'lifetime of dog' licence, which costs €140 and is valid for the dog’s lifetime. A general dog licence, which costs €400 and is valid for 1 year. This covers an unspecified number of dogs at one location. You can apply for an individual or lifetime dog licence at your ... WebJun 29, 2024 · In The Illustrated Book of the Dog, published in 1881, George R. Krehl, an advocate of the breed at the time, said "…the Irish Terrier is a true and distinct breed to Ireland and no man can trace its origin, which is lost in antiquity." At the time the book was published, the Irish terrier was the fourth most popular dog in Ireland and England.
WebAug 27, 2024 · The animal charity Dogs Trust Ireland has said they have seen a sharp rise in the numbers of dogs being handed in for adoption. DTI said they are now getting at least eight requests every day from people who wish to surrender their dogs as lockdown restrictions ease.
